CMD317 1-24 GHz Distributed Driver Amplifier Product Overview Key Features The CMD317 is a wideband GaAs MMIC driver amplifier Wide Bandwidth ideally suited for military, space and communications High Linearity systems where small size and high linearity are needed. At Single Positive Supply Voltage 12 GHz the device delivers 16 dB of gain with a On Chip Bias Choke corresponding output 1 dB compression point of +23 dBm and an output IP3 of 34 dBm. The CMD317 is a 50 ohm matched design which eliminates the need for RF port Ordering Information matching and includes an on chip bias choke.
